LONG BEACH (CBSLA.com) — A police pursuit ended Thursday morning with the fatal shooting of a residential burglary suspect in Long Beach, authorities said.
The pursuit began just after 1 a.m. in Redondo Beach after local police responded to a burglary call and discovered that a 2012 BMW was stolen.
The California Highway Patrol spotted the white sedan on the southbound 405 Freeway and a pursuit ensued.
The unidentified suspect exited the freeway at Studebaker and the chase was picked up by the Long Beach Police Department, officials said.
Authorities followed the suspect to a residential neighborhood near Palo Verde Avenue and Los Coyotes Diagonal where he crashed the vehicle into a garage in the 6400 block of Keynote Street near Hackett Avenue.
The suspect exited the BMW, pointed a gun at police and fired.
